Job Description
As a Data Platform Engineer, you will play a pivotal role in establishing OMIX3, a cutting-edge data platform for research and clinical samples. You will develop innovative digital solutions to enable sharing and analysis of human omic and phenotype data.
* Pipeline Development: Create production-grade tools for automated data flows, including archiving, cataloguing, and analysis of sensitive human omics datasets.
* System Integration: Collaborate with cross-functional teams to design and implement new software features and integration points.
* Quality Assurance: Design and execute test plans, lead code reviews, and maintain high-quality codebases.
* Stakeholder Engagement: Work with diverse stakeholders to align technical solutions with project needs.
Required Skills and Qualifications
To be successful in this role, you will need:
* A strong passion for data pipelines and systems integration.
* Strong problem-solving abilities and a commitment to high-quality engineering.
* Extensive experience developing robust, release-quality Python code.
* Deep understanding of ETL processes and data processing.
* Experience with Unix/Linux command-line utilities and shell scripting.
* Commitment to continuous learning and excellent communication skills.
